Can you take e cigs on airplanes?

Yes, in most cases you may bring e cigarettes and vape devices on flights, but almost always only in your hand luggage or on your person, not in checked baggage. Do children need a passport to travel within Schengen

Children do not always need a passport to travel within Schengen, but they must always have a valid travel document. Can infants have their own seat on a flight

Yes, infants can have their own seat on a flight, but it requires that you buy a separate ticket for the child instead of traveling with the infant on your lap.
